Paper Summary
This paper proposes a way to use Bitcoin for payments between Earth and Mars, taking into account the long communication delays. It introduces "Proof-of-Transit Timestamping" (PoTT) to track Bitcoin transactions between planets and suggests using existing technologies like the Lightning Network and sidechains to make payments faster and more efficient.
